I kept Kathy's dark bg; a large white floral die; pops of red; and a butterfly...or butterflies in my case. I loved her red, white and navy blue colors, but switched out her navy for black. I also cut the die out in red to add back in back the flower centers. I cut the three little butterflies from the red die cut and glued them slightly off center from the white to make them pop a bit more. And, I added a sentiment.
I love the bold look she created and I am very happy that my not-much-used floral die looks so good against the black. I can see doing this again with many different color combos.
